How do I change the date format in Excel macro?
How do I change the date format in Excel macro?
NumberFormat property, I explain the different date format codes you can use and present 25 date formatting examples using VBA.
- Step #1: Go To The Number Tab Of The Format Cells Dialog Box.
- Step #2: Select The Date Category.
- Step #3: Choose The Date Format Type Whose Format Code You Want.
How do I change the date format in a VBA macro?
Step 2: Write the subprocedure for VBA Format Date or choose anything to define the module. Step 3: Choose the range cell first as A1. Step 4: Then use the Number Format function as shown below. Step 5: As per the syntax of the Format function, choose the format by which we want to change the Date of the selected cell.
How do I preset a date format in Excel?
Setting a Default Date Format
- Select the cell (or cells) you want to format.
- Choose Cells from the Format menu.
- Make sure the Number tab is selected.
- Click Date at the left side of the dialog box.
- Using the Locale drop-down list, choose a country or region that uses the date format you want to use.
What is the date format in VBA?
The default short date format is m/d/yy . Display a date serial number as a complete date (including day, month, and year) formatted according to the long date setting recognized by your system. The default long date format is mmmm dd, yyyy .
How do you set a date variable in VBA?
To declare a date, use the Dim statement. To initialize a date, use the DateValue function. Note: Use Month and Day to get the month and day of a date.
What format is DD MMM YYYY?
Date/Time Formats
Format | Description |
---|---|
DD/MMM/YYYY | Two-digit day, separator, three-letter abbreviation of the month, separator, four-digit year (example: 25/JUL/2003) |
MMM/DD/YYYY | Three-letter abbreviation of the month, separator, two-digit day, separator, four-digit year (example: JUL/25/2003) |
Why can’t I change the date format in Excel?
Try this method if Excel doesn’t change the date format Click the Data tab from the top menu of your screen. Choose the Text to columns option from the menu. Select the Custom format option found at the bottom of the list. In the text box -> type YYYY/MM/DDD -> press Ok.
How do I convert a date in Excel without losing formatting?
Here are the steps:
- Select the cells that have dates that you want to convert and copy it.
- Open a Notepad and paste it there.
- Now switch back to the Excel and select the cells where you want to paste these dates.
- With the cells selected, go to Home –> Number and select the Text format (from the drop down).
How do I declare a date in VBA?
How do you format a date in VBA?
Excel VBA Format Date To format a date in VBA we use the inbuilt FORMAT function itself, it takes input as the date format and returns the desired format required, the arguments required for this function are the expression itself and the format type.
Are there macros that format dates in Excel?
Generally, as you become more familiar with number format codes, you’ll be able to create macros that format dates without having to go through this every time. For these purposes, refer to the introduction to date format codes below. You can get to the Format Cells dialog box using any of the following methods:
How do I create a custom date format in Excel?
Creating a custom date format in Excel. Press Ctrl+1 to open the Format Cells dialog. On the Number tab, select Custom from the Category list and type the date format you want in the Type box. Tip. The easiest way to set a custom date format in Excel is to start from an existing format close to what you want.
Which is the default date format in Excel?
NumberFormat – Dates. The default number format of a cell in Excel is General. You can display values as numbers, text, dates, percentages or currencies by changing the number format. The NumberFormat property can be used in VBA to set the number format of dates in a cell or range.